Is Plastic Surgery Right for Me?

Consider plastic surgery only if you:

  • Have a positive attitude
  • Are generally healthy
  • Eat well, exercise and don’t smoke
  • Don’t expect treatment to make you look perfect or be more popular or successful
  • Don’t feel pressured by anyone to change how you look

Cosmetic & Reconstructive Treatments

Ask a plastic surgeon if one of these procedures or another treatment can help you meet your goals for your appearance.

Breast Augmentation

Breast augmentation uses artificial implants or fat from your body to make your breasts larger and fuller. Most likely, you’ll receive implants made of silicone gel or saline. The implants don’t last forever, and a surgeon may eventually need to perform an implant repair. After surgery, schedule follow-up appointments as often as your doctor recommends.

Breast Reconstruction

Following a mastectomy, or breast removal, a surgeon can make new breasts on your body using artificial implants or fat from your body. You can get this treatment either right after mastectomy or at another time, depending on your needs. A few months after breast reconstruction, a surgeon can create a natural-looking nipple and areola using tissue from your body.

We also specialize in flap and tissue expansion, which many cancer patients prefer.

Breast Reduction

Whether you’re a woman or man, a plastic surgeon can reduce your breasts to a size you feel is right for your body. This procedure can help ease back, neck or shoulder pain, or treat gynecomastia (breast growth in men). Before getting this treatment, try to achieve a healthy weight.

Brow Lift

A brow lift can make you look more youthful and energetic by raising sagging eyebrows and reducing wrinkles on the forehead and between the eyes.

Eyelid Surgery

Reduce eyelid droopiness or puffiness with eyelid surgeries, such as eyelid lifts. A surgeon will remove extra fat and skin while reducing tiny wrinkles. If you have outwardly turned eyelids, which can happen with the lower eyelid in particular, we also provide ectropion repair.

Facelift

Tighten muscles and decrease wrinkles and fat throughout your face with a full facelift. Or ask your surgeon about a mini facelift (lower facelift) that targets the cheeks, neck and jaw area.

Liposuction

Liposuction removes extra fat to slim parts of your body, such as your waist, hips, thighs, butt, arms or face. Your surgeon can perform this treatment at the same time as a tummy tuck, breast reduction or some other surgeries. Before getting this treatment, exercise and eat healthfully to reach the right weight for your height.

Nose Job

Shrink, enlarge or reshape your nose with rhinoplasty. A surgeon might move or remove some nasal tissue, bone or cartilage to repair an injury, make breathing easier or help you feel better about how your face looks.

Tummy Tuck

Reduce fat and remove loose skin on your abdomen with abdominoplasty. Unlike liposuction, a tummy tuck tightens muscles around your stomach. Before getting this treatment, exercise and eat healthfully to reach the right weight for your height.
